Product SiteDocumentation Site

31.3.5. Хранилище файлов и ядер

Хранилище файлов и ядер позволяет хранить простые файлы, которые будут использоваться в качестве ядер ВМ, виртуальных дисков или любых других файлов, которые необходимо передать ВМ в процессе контекстуализации. Данное хранилище не предоставляет никакого специального механизма хранения, но представляет простой и безопасный способ использования файлов в шаблонах ВМ.
Чтобы создать новое хранилище файлов и ядер, необходимо указать следующие параметры:
  • NAME — название хранилища;
  • TYPE — FILE_DS;
  • DS_MAD — fs;
  • TM_MAD — ssh.
Зарегистрировать хранилище файлов и ядер можно как веб-интерфейсе Sunstone, так и в командной строке. Например, для создания хранилища файлов и ядер можно создать файл fileds.conf со следующим содержимым:
NAME    = local_file
DS_MAD  = fs
TM_MAD  = ssh
TYPE    = FILE_DS
И выполнить команду:
$ onedatastore create fileds.conf
ID: 105

Примечание

Выше приведены рекомендованные значения DS_MAD и TM_MAD, но можно использовать любые другие.
Для того чтобы изменить параметры хранилища, можно создать файл с необходимыми настройками (пример см.выше) и выпонить команду:
$ onedatastore update <идентификатор_хранилища> <имя_файла>